Assignment:
Letter to the Editor: Should the United States enter the Great War?
Directions: The date is April 5th, 1917, and you have been following the arguments for and against U.S. entry into the Great War for the past few days. After reading about Senator Norris' response to President Wilson in today's edition of The Washington Post, you decide to write to the editor in which you either support or oppose U.S. entry into the war. In your letter, you must present a clear argument for or against the war and support your position using evidence from BOTH documents. In other words, whose argument do you agree with the most: President Wilson or Senator Norris? Why?
